    The nominal GDP was estimated at $19 billion in 2020, [4] with a per capita GDP amounting to $2,500. In 2018 government spending amounted to $15.9 billion, [27] or 23% of GDP. The Lebanese economy went through a significant expansion after the 34-day war of 2006, with growth averaging 9.1% between 2007 and 2010. [28]

    In 2007, the region had an unemployment rate of 6.1%, while overall jobless claims in California were at 5.4% and 4.4% nationally. In 2008, unemployment in the area increased to 9.5%, at a time when the state average was 8.2% and the national average approximately 6.5%.
